    I find with the two sites I run a gaming (display ads) and music (link units) niche I get paid per click with the display ads. But when A user clicks a link unit ad I am finding with the link units I do not get credit for a 'click' unless an individual clicks a second link on the next landing page. is this true?

    I am also having another issue where the keywords of the link units have nothing to do with the landing pages. I reported that to adsense. I am new at this.     If anyone is clicking on the link unit ad then he needs to click on the ads from the next page and then only it will counted as a valid click.

    Learn the terminology and you'll be more at ease to understand.
    There are:
    ad units
    link units

    ad units are the common adsense, you get paid for one click on one of the ads inside.
    link units are the small boxes with keywords/links, when someone click them they are shown a page full of ads. If they click on one ad you get money, if not, nothing.

    The link units ressemble menus or navigation bar, so they should be placed accordingly, in sidebars or below navigation menus (depends on the format of the link unit, box or horizontal line).
    Ad units ressemble content links and so should be placed accordingly around or inside the content.
